Sorry to disappoint anyone who read the headline and might have been expecting a big screen remake of the classic sitcom. The Good Life is a small, independent, coming-of-age drama with almost no chance of a guest appearance by Richard Briers.

The film, which will be helmer by first-time writer-director Steve Berra, tells the story of a young man struggling to fit into a town that clearly doesn’t suit him. Broken Flowers’ Mark Webber is our hero, with Zooey Deschanel (Hitchhiker’s Guide To The Galaxy) as his love interest, the one person who understands him. Also signing on are Bill Paxton, Chris Klein, Cinderella Man’s Bruce McGill and Harry Dean Stanton.

Berra has just kicked off shooting in Winnipeg, Canada.
